We are looking to appoint a committed and enthusiastic Teaching Assistant to support teaching and learning across our school. The role will involve working with children in small groups or on a one-to-one basis, assisting with assessment and learning evidence, supporting educational visits, and working alongside teachers to create engaging classroom environments and resources.
